What is the easiest medical school to get into in Australia?

University of Queensland Medical School

The University of Queensland has a large pool of applicants, accepting as many as 455 students per year. The GPA is valued at 50/50 with the multiple mini-interview (MMI) should the applicant make it to that stage, but the GPA is used as a tiebreaker when necessary.

What is the biggest hospital in Australia?

The Royal Brisbane and Women's Hospital (RBWH) is by far the biggest hospital in Australia, with a whopping 1000 beds! Operated by the Queensland government, it offers comprehensive public health services, specialty care, research and tertiary teaching opportunities.

Which country has the most medical schools?

Results: There are about 2600 medical schools worldwide. The countries with the largest numbers of schools are India (n = 304), Brazil (n = 182), the USA (n = 173), China (n = 147) and Pakistan (n = 86). One-third of all medical schools are located in five countries and nearly half are located in 10 countries.

Which country graduates the most doctors?

In response to current and possible future concerns about doctor shortages, developed countries have started churning out more and more medical graduates. According to the OECD's latest Health at a Glance report, Ireland has the highest number of medical graduates per 100,000 of its population at 23.7.
